The villa is surrounded by lush vegetation, with a magnificent view of the Pacific Ocean. Enjoy the soothing sound of the waves. Spectacular sunsets can be enjoyed from all the terraces. The villa has 3 terraces, all with views of the ocean and comfortable sofas and chairs. The lower terrace has a jacuzzi for 6 and a palapa with comfortable seating. The sunny middle terrace has a pool and a large patio area with lots of lounge chairs and a bar. The upper terrace is shaded and furnished with couches and love seats.

First on the list of the many amenities is the cook, Yolanda, who prepares wonderful meals of the local seafood, Mexican cuisine, or American favorites. Carlos, Yolanda's husband, buys your seafood, meats and vegetables fresh every day and is available to do your other errands. The rooms are cleaned daily by a maid.

You have access to a private beach, that only the guests of Villa Paraiso have access to and some local fishermen. It is a 10 minute walk down to the beach. It is more difficult to return, 15 minutes all uphill.

The sound system is an amplifier with Bluetooth, CD and AUX and powers indoor and outdoor speakers. The wifi reaches all areas of the villa. All of the bedrooms have air conditioning and ceiling fans.

I have been a regular visitor to Acapulco since the early 70s and this is my dream house. I have owned it since the year 2000 and I go as often as I can when it is not rented. I am Mexican and have travelled to all the beaches in Mexico but none of them rivals Acapulco for beauty. I have a long history with this villa and when the opportunity arose to buy it, I couldn't refuse.

Why they chose this property

The villa is located midway between the hotel district of Acapulco and Pie de la Cuesta. The compound on which the property is located has three villas; one of which was Johnny Weissmuller's, the original Tarzan. The homes are built on a hillside overlooking the Pacific with a perfect sunset view.

Acapulco is no longer the small resort of the 50s and 60s, it has grown to a large bustling city but Villa Paraiso remains secluded and quiet with only the sound of the ocean. I go there for rest and relaxation. It is only 15 minutes from the hotel and tourist area so I can easily entertain guests with restaurants and nightlife. It is also only 15 minutes from Pie de la Cuesta where they can enjoy water sports in the lagoon, tour wildlife areas or eat at the boutique hotels and restaurants. Visit and enjoy a Mexican villa and experience the real Mexico. This isn't your typical Mexican resort with more Americans than Mexicans. Acapulco is now the beach destination of Mexicans and Europeans. If you are an American or European who would like to experience the real Mexico, this is your choice.
